How to care for your baby's nails and trim them regularly: Your baby's nails grow very fast, and it's easy to hide evil people, so you must trim your baby's nails regularly, about once a week. Pay attention to the timing of pruning: because young babies are prone to waving wildly, it is very dangerous to trim their nails while awake. It's best to trim the baby while he is sleeping. Older children can sing and tell stories to comfort him. Use safety scissors: To help your baby trim his nails, you must use the safety scissors special for your baby, and it is best not to mix them with others, so as not to cause other skin diseases.
